문제

일부 프로젝트 (C# .csproj 프로젝트)가 실제 빌드 시스템의 일부인 경우 수명주기와 자동화 된 빌드 프로세스를 어떻게 관리 하시겠습니까?

예 : .csproj BuildEnv.csproj 에 구현 된 MSBuild 작업을 사용하는 프로젝트입니다. 두 프로젝트 모두 동일한 제품의 일부입니다 (즉, BuildEnv.csproj 는 거의 업데이트되지 않는 타사가 아니라 제품이 개발됨에 따라 자주 변경됨).

도움이 되었습니까?

해결책

이를 두 개의 개별 "프로젝트"로 분리해야합니다. 그렇지 않으면 손상된 빌드가 빌드 시스템의 변경으로 인한 것인지 개발중인 코드의 차이로 인한 것인지 알아 내기 위해 오랜 시간을 할애해야합니다.

이전에는 두 시스템을 CVS에서 별도의 프로젝트로 분리했습니다.

포렌식 분석을 수행 할 때 확인해야하는 항목을 제한하기 위해 다른 하나는 일정하게 유지하면서 한 가지를 다양하게 할 수 있기를 원합니다.

도움이되기를 바랍니다.

라이센스 : CC-BY-SA ~와 함께 속성
제휴하지 않습니다 StackOverflow
scroll top